3 Benefits of Using an Acrylic Render on Your Home


If your house looks worn and has some surface damage, then you might be thinking about having your exterior walls rendered. Before you decide which render to use on this job, consider using an acrylic product. Read on to learn more.

1. Get Longer-Term Protection

Any type of render gives exterior walls some extra protection. It keeps dampness and moisture out of your home by creating a watertight barrier on your walls. It also covers minor defects and wears.

Plus, this barrier also has insulative properties. When you add a layer of render to a wall, you make the wall thicker. This increases its insulation efficiency. So, you'll waste less energy and reduce your energy costs.

While most renders have these advantages, acrylic products take things a step further. These renders contain plastics. Therefore, they have the ability to flex.

While other renders might crack over time when your home goes through its natural contraction and expansion cycle, an acrylic render shouldn't break under this stress. Its flexibility enables it to stay in one piece without cracking.

So, the render will retain its good looks and its structural properties for longer. Your walls and home get longer-term protection.

2. Get a Fast Kerb Appeal Boost

If your home looks old and tired, then it might not have major problems that need fixing. It might simply need some cosmetic renovation.

If you're tired or embarrassed by the way your home currently looks, then rendering can rejuvenate it. You can smooth out wear and tear and cover minor defects that make your home look ugly. Your home gets a completely fresh surface coating that improves its kerb appeal.

If you want to move fast here, then an acrylic render is a good option. Some concrete renders can take weeks to cure and finish; however, acrylic renders only take a few days. Your home will look better faster.

Plus, acrylic renders come in a range of colours and textures. You can change the way your home looks completely if you wish.

3. Increase the Value of Your Home

If you're thinking of selling your home in the short-to-medium term, then an acrylic render is a good investment. It could even increase the value of your property.

For example, a render will make your home look fresh and new. It will be more attractive to buyers.

Plus, once people know that you've used an acrylic product on your walls, then they have extra confidence that the render will last for longer without cracking. They know that they will also benefit from its extended damp protection and insulation. Your home might become a more attractive prospect.
